Handover: Shrinkwright CLI

Taking over batch image resizing duties? A few careful notes: the nightly Shrinkwright run processes the marketing bucket at 01:00. Failures retry three times, then land in the dead-letter folder — check it each morning. Never raise concurrency past eight; the resize workers share memory with the thumbnailer. The run uses the following configuration values.

service settings:
PRAIX_LOG_LEVEL=error
PRAIX_METRICS_HOST=metrics.praix.qorvelcorp.corp
PRAIX_POOL_SIZE=16

Internal Memo – Customer Concentration Risk

To all branch managers. Our largest account, Drayfield Holdings, now represents 41% of group revenue, up from 29% last year. This exposure exceeds our internal threshold. Branches should prioritise pipeline diversification and report new mid-tier prospects weekly to regional leads. No changes to Drayfield service levels in the interim. The mitigation plan is outlined below.

internal memo for kawip-hadug: Headcount on the Wenwyn team goes from 7 to 140 by the end of January. Gross margin on Wenwyn came in at 20 percent against a plan of 15 percent.

Handover — shrinkray CLI

Hey, quick one before I'm out: shrinkray (our batch image resizer) is stable, but the EXIF-stripping flag occasionally chokes on files from the Quillby uploader. Workaround is rerunning with --no-meta. Queue backlogs clear themselves overnight, so don't panic at alerts before 2am. If anything truly breaks, page the new owner listed below.

approver of bajeg-bajef = Istion Pelys Holax Wenox

Handover for Priya-to-Marten desk swap. Visitors for Calloway Systems sign in on the tablet, get a grey lanyard, wait by the planters. Call the host; don't send anyone up unescorted. Couriers: parcels go in the cage, perishables to the kitchenette. Lost-property log lives in the second drawer. The side door to the meeting corridor locks at 17:30 — after that, let visitors through with the code below.

staff pass of kawip-hawef = bdg-QLP-2